Output 5021088239963fdabac874dfd5981a702addb97d7f6cf0d6264c502f976d5d7d:5

value
5370737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76eb38fa023e4c922eb25a6f23dce7a05265dacb OP_EQUAL
address
3CXoSjJCyJ6Vi4BVbGVqH7DfUiTEY5oVzy
transaction
5021088239963fdabac874dfd5981a702addb97d7f6cf0d6264c502f976d5d7d
confirmations
341139
spent
true